Output 84e44608b260e3fbb268ed16c70d5d5203d9240b833eac0c132c7f04b9fc9a3e:0

value
5154439
script pubkey
OP_0 OP_PUSHBYTES_20 23b1f843d285b13be9b42f2b5ad006b1bd448b8e
address
bc1qywclss7jskcnh6d59u4445qxkx75fzuwrvfd5u
transaction
84e44608b260e3fbb268ed16c70d5d5203d9240b833eac0c132c7f04b9fc9a3e
spent
true